Senior Consultant, Forensic Accounting
As a Project - Senior Consultant, Forensics and Investigations, on the project, you will:
- Work independently to solve complex problems and evaluate controls associated with complex business relationships.
- In support of Federal investigations and prosecutions, the Forensic Accountant will perform complex analysis of financial and business records to support Federal investigations and prosecutions by using criminal investigative tools and other client-owned databases.
- Utilize in-depth knowledge of procedures and techniques as generally prescribed under American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A) disciplines, and current and anticipated banking anti-money laundering regulations and practices.
- Apply knowledge to the enforcement of Title 18, Title 31 and other applicable statutes of the Federal Criminal Code, and the seizure and forfeiture of illegally derived property; and may be responsible for serving as a Factual Witness.
